Output 65bc7dfb200f3d628b8cf8ce843a80eb450b76faf7686c24238bea1138a71063:3

value
837900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b12fdb6232530d363e4a46e7c15ebd7bf470c5f OP_EQUALVERIFY OP_CHECKSIG
address
16PMcqinVG1eEBEaswRp8my2h7mdvDnxnb
transaction
65bc7dfb200f3d628b8cf8ce843a80eb450b76faf7686c24238bea1138a71063
spent
true